Shehzad Poonawalla, who recently quit the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P), continued his sharp attacks on Rahul Gandhi and the Congress on Monday, raising the reported serving of fish at a public event in Uttar Pradesh’s Ayodhya during Sawan .
“The same Ayodhya, which is one of the holiest places, one of the most sacred places for Hindu faith, for Sanatan faith – the Congress party publicly displays fish and serves fish during the month of Sawan. He was referring to a purported video of fish being cooked at a Nishad community event in Ayodhya in which state Congress chief Ajay Rai reportedly partook.
